Under the direction of the Financial Reporting Consolidation Manager, the Senior Financial Reporting Accountant (Sr. FRA) is responsible for preparing and reviewing complex financial reports for internal and external stakeholders, these include the CFO, Operations Strategic Team (OST), Leadership Team, funders, grantors, and government agencies. The Sr. FRA will prepare tax-related reports for CCRC's external tax team in preparation of the 990 Tax Returns and assist in analyzing situations and methods of accounting treatments specific to non-profits.

Essential Duties And Responsibilities

Within a team structure, this position will perform the following responsibilities :

Financial Reporting & Consolidation (50%)

  • Prepare and review to ensure accuracy and completeness of monthly, quarterly, and annual financial report package in accordance with accounting policy and GAAP as required for VP & CFO to present to the OST, Leadership Team, Finance Committee, Board of Directors, and external parties in a timely and accurate fashion (e.g. bankers).
  • Collaborate with CFO / VP, FR&C Manager Grants Director FP&A Director and Accounting Manager monthly to review and discuss financial package.

Financial Analysis & Recording (20%)

  • Prepare and review monthly reconciliations, identifying and resolving discrepancies to ensure accurate financial reporting.
  • Assist in conducting variance analysis by comparing budgeted versus actual financial performance, identifying key drivers and deviations.
  • Support the preparation and recording of GAAP-compliant lease adjustments, including the calculation of right-of-use assets and lease liabilities.
  • Prepare GAAP elimination adjustments for consolidation purposes and depreciation allocation for billing purposes.
  • Assist in establishing month-end, quarter-end, and year-end close calendars in coordination with the GM Director and Accounting Manager to help ensure closing deadlines are met and issues are addressed promptly. Support the FR&C Manager in monitoring the month-end closing process and help keep the VP & CFO informed of emerging issues that may impact financial and tax reporting
  • Compliance & Regulatory Reporting (25%)

  • Prepare audit schedules and complete work assigned related to annual financial audit.
  • Coordinate, prepare, and review information requested by outside tax accountants for annual tax filings. Stay current and knowledgeable on accounting standards (GAAP), agency contract funding terms and conditions and guidelines or regulations that relate to responsibilities. Research technical accounting issue or topic and prepare recommendation on correct treatment and reporting of financial transactions that arise.
  • Ensure compliance with legislation, federal (OMB circulars) and funding requirements and state regulations and laws. Maintain adequate record keeping for compliance.
  • Documentation & Reporting Standards (5%)

  • Develop, document, and maintain financial reporting standards, policies, and procedures to ensure consistency, accuracy, and compliance across the organization.
  • Ensure that all financial reports and statements are clearly documented and ready for internal or external review, ensuring transparency in the financial reporting process.

As a grant-funded Agency supporting Children and Family Services, CCRC conducts background checks commensurate with the role to verify candidate qualifications (criminal history, employment history / experience, education, reference checks) and ensure grant compliance. Specific roles may have additional verification / clearance to the standard background check as part of the recruitment and selection process, including :
  • Live Scan Clearance / DOJ Fingerprinting : For positions working directly with the public in a child / community care or child / community care adjacent setting (CA Health and Safety Code Section 1596.871 and / or Head Start Program Performance Standards 1302.90).

  • Health Clearance : For positions working directly with the public in a child / community care or child / community care adjacent setting or working with "at risk" populations, CA Code of Regulations Title 22,
  • 101216, CA Health and Safety Code 1596.7995, and / or Head Start Program Performance Standards 1302.93)
  • MVR / DMV clearance in accordance with CCRC's liability insurance provisions : For positions where driving is required.
  • Child Development Permit : For positions working in an educational capacity (California Education Code Sections 44242.5, 44340, and 44341)
  • CPR / Pediatric CPR certification : For certain identified positions working directly with the public in a child / community care or child / community care adjacent setting (CA Health & Safety Code 1596.865 - 1596.866)
  • Federal Debarment Checks : For positions acting in a principal capacity to federal funds (Head Start Program Performance Standards 1304.11, Code of Federal Regulations Title 2 Grants and Agreements 2.180.320 and 2.180.995)
